Chuli Bagriyan (8) is a Rural village located in Adampur, Hisar, Haryana.
The total population of Chuli Bagriyan (8) is 4,730.
Chuli Bagriyan (8) village comprises 927 households.
The literacy rate in Chuli Bagriyan (8) is 71%. Among the literate population of 3,030, there are 1,858 literate males and 1,172 literate females.
In Chuli Bagriyan (8), there are 2,495 males and 2,235 females, with a sex ratio of 896 females per 1000 males.
There are 460 children (9.7% of population), comprising 248 boys and 212 girls.
The total number of workers in Chuli Bagriyan (8) is 1,723, with 1,405 main workers and 318 marginal workers.
In Chuli Bagriyan (8), there are 858 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(466 males, 392 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Chuli Bagriyan (8) is located in Haryana state, Hisar district, and falls under Adampur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 60839 and LGD code is 60839.
